SLAICO has historically been an innovator in providing various lines of health coverage including their new UltiCare limited medical insurance product with claims administered by HGI, a third party administrator. The UltiCare plan provides first dollar coverage for common everyday occurrences such as doctor visits, labs, x-rays, and inpatient or outpatient surgery. In addition all plans include a critical illness benefit and provide prescription drug benefits insured through other carriers.

Revolutionizing the Medical Claims Process
The ClaimPay solution merges the financial transaction and claims adjudication process into one seamless transaction. The SLAICO and HGI program allows medical professionals to automate the verification of benefits resulting in immediate payment to the ClaimPay MasterCard. Once submitted through the ClaimPayonline.com portal, network discounts are applied and the claim is adjudicated almost instantly. In fact, medical providers can view if their reimbursement is available from the insurance company within 11 seconds.
